When Henrietta gets a phone call telling her that she is going to be laid off of her job, her first response is fear and shock.

In response to this stressor, her hypothalamus sends a signal to her pituitary gland to release a hormone called _____________.

Answer: cortisol

Explanation:

Cortisol is a steroid hormone, in the glucocorticoid class of hormones. Cortisol nature’s built-in alarm system. It’s your body’s main stress hormone. It works with certain parts of your brain to control your mood, motivation, and fear. It is produced in the adrenal gland.

When the body is faced with stressors such as shock and fear. The hypothalamus releases corticotropin-releasing hormone (CRH), which travels to the pituitary gland, triggering the release of adrenocorticotropic hormone (ACTH). This hormone travels to the adrenal glands, prompting them to release cortisol. The body thus stays revved up and on high alert.
